Apparatus and method for quantized convergent direction-based ray sorting

1. An apparatus comprising:
execution circuitry coupled to non-transitory machine-readable storage medium that stores instructions, which when executed by the execution circuitry, are capable of performing:
generating ray direction data based on intersection tests of a plurality of rays with a hierarchical tree structure of bounding boxes, the hierarchical tree structure of bounding boxes to test intersection between the plurality of rays and objects enclosed by the hierarchical tree structure of bounding boxes; and
sorting the plurality of rays into a plurality of ray groups based on the ray direction data.
